Lions activate LB James Houston from injured reserve
Aug 25, 2023; Charlotte, North Carolina, USA; Carolina Panthers quarterback Bryce Young (9) drops back under pressure from Detroit Lions linebacker James Houston (41) during the first quarter at Bank of America Stadium. credits: Jim Dedmon-USA TODAY Sports The Detroit Lions activated James Houston from injured reserve on Thursday and waived fellow linebacker Julian Okwara.
Houston was designated to return from IR on Dec. 28. He had been sidelined since fracturing his right ankle in Detroit's 37-31 overtime loss to the Seattle Seahawks on Sept. 17.
Houston is in line to play on Sunday afternoon when the Lions host the Tampa Bay Buccaneers in an NFC divisional round playoff game.
"I'm ready to get out there," Houston said, per the Detroit Free Press. "It looks like it's fun. They're winning and the whole city is behind them, so I want to be out there."
Houston, 25, recorded eight sacks in seven games (two starts) last season after being selected by the Lions in the sixth round of the 2022 NFL Draft.
Okwara, 26, has totaled seven tackles and two sacks in nine games (one start) this season.
